Ukrainians at the passport center in Warsaw: The state has put us in a hopeless situation

Journalists from the French publication AFP spoke with citizens of Ukraine who, on the instructions of Kyiv, are denied consular services, including the registration and issuance of new passports necessary to continue their stay abroad.

In particular, in the branch of the Ukrainian passport center in Warsaw, where conflict situations arose the day before due to the refusal of the Ukrainian mission to issue even previously ordered passports.



Commenting to a French publication on the situation created as a result of the order of the Ukrainian Foreign Ministry, Ukrainians who were unsuccessfully waiting for their documents complained that in the eyes of Kyiv, even those citizens who managed to travel abroad on a legal basis are considered draft dodgers.

In addition, Ukrainian citizens who left their country long before Zelensky closed the borders also faced problems in obtaining new passports and other documents. At the same time, the issuance of documents is denied even to those citizens whose passports are already ready. The money paid for processing passports (and Ukrainian embassies and consulates charge $130 for this service) is, of course, not returned.

It is also reported that Polish Defense Minister Wladyslaw Kosiniak-Kamysh said that Warsaw is ready to help Kyiv return men of military age to Ukraine. The head of the Polish military department noted that many Poles are outraged by the sight of young Ukrainian men in hotels and cafes.
